BaseValueSource Enumeração
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Identifica a fonte do sistema de propriedades de um determinado valor de propriedade dependente.
public enum class BaseValueSource
public enum BaseValueSource
type BaseValueSource =
Public Enum BaseValueSource
- Herança
Campos
| Name | Valor | Description |
|---|---|---|
| Unknown | 0 | A origem é desconhecida. Este é o valor padrão. |
| Default | 1 | Source é o valor padrão, definido pelos metadados da propriedade. |
| Inherited | 2 | A fonte é um valor através da herança do valor da propriedade. |
| DefaultStyle | 3 | A fonte é de um levantador no estilo padrão. O estilo padrão vem do tema atual. |
| DefaultStyleTrigger | 4 | A fonte é de um gatilho no estilo padrão. O estilo padrão vem do tema atual. |
| Style | 5 | A fonte é de um criador de estilos que não tem a ver com o tema. |
| TemplateTrigger | 6 | Source é um valor baseado em gatilho num modelo que provém de um estilo não temático. |
| StyleTrigger | 7 | Source é um valor baseado em gatilho de um estilo não temático. |
| ImplicitStyleReference | 8 | Source é uma referência de estilo implícita (o estilo baseava-se no tipo detetado ou baseado no tipo). Este valor é devolvido apenas para a propriedade Style em si, não para propriedades que são definidas através de setters ou triggers desse estilo. |
| ParentTemplate | 9 | Source baseia-se num template pai usado por um elemento. |
| ParentTemplateTrigger | 10 | Source é um valor baseado em gatilho proveniente de um modelo pai que criou o elemento. |
| Local | 11 | Source é um valor localmente definido. |
Observações
Esta enumeração é usada por uma propriedade dentro da ValueSource estrutura, que por sua vez é obtida ao chamar um GetValueSource método contra uma propriedade de dependência particular.
Cada valor desta enumeração indica que um determinado aspeto do sistema global de propriedades WPF era responsável pela determinação do valor efetivo de um determinado valor de propriedade de dependência num objeto de dependência específico. Para saber mais sobre o sistema de propriedades WPF e a precedência em que cada aspeto do sistema de propriedades opera, consulte Dependency Property Value Precedence.
O valor Default não é o valor padrão da enumeração.